Key Skills to Look For
Geological Mapping
A geologist should be proficient in creating detailed geological maps that are essential for understanding the geological structure of an area.
Knowledge of Geological Software
Familiarity with software like ArcGIS, QGIS, or specialized geological modeling tools is crucial for data analysis and presentation.
Fieldwork Experience
Experience in conducting fieldwork, including sample collection and site assessment, is vital for a geologist.
Understanding of Geological Processes
A strong understanding of geological processes, including tectonic activities and sedimentation, is necessary.
Communication Skills
Good communication skills are required to effectively convey complex geological information to stakeholders.
Analytical Skills
Strong analytical skills are needed to interpret geological data and draw meaningful conclusions.
Familiarity with Local Geology
Knowledge of the local geology of Rawalpindi and surrounding areas is a significant advantage.
Project Management
Ability to manage projects from conception to completion, including coordinating with teams and stakeholders.

Sample Interview Questions for Geologist
Here are some sample interview questions:
- Can you describe a challenging geological project you worked on?
- How do you stay updated with the latest developments in geology?
- What methods do you use for geological mapping?
- How do you assess geological hazards?
- Can you explain your experience with geological software?
- How do you handle fieldwork challenges?
